I paid $150 for the unit including shipping. I could have bought the same unit on Amazon for $187 including shipping at the time. Amazon's price is now $199 including shipping. The delivery of the printer was delayed by UPS error through no fault of Mr. Kerans, but, at this point, I was badly in need of the printer and attempted to set it up.
When I received the printer and opened the container, I first noticed that the printer cartridge had been used and resealed in the plastic bag. The usual pull-strips were absent and there was toner all over the cartridge. I also noticed that some of the parts had apparently been opened and resealed in the plastic envelopes. Additionally, the advertised CD software and manual were absent.
I printed out a test report and discovered that the printer/fax had been used as early as October, 2008, or, approximately ten months prior to my purchase. There were several personal and business-related faxes that were either sent by or received by Mr. Kerans' still stored in the printer's memory and a page count of over 150.
Since I was unsuccessful in installing the printer, I contacted Hewlett-Packard for assistance and was informed that the printer's USB port was defective.
When I informed Mr Kerans of my findings, I received rude, unprofessional, and accusatory insults too numerous and ridiculous to mention. Ultimately, he admitted that the printer had been USED as a demo/floor model but continues to assert that the printer is "new" despite clear evidence to the contrary.
I offered to accept a partial refund from Mr Kerans, but retracted it following his repeated insults and accusations as well as my discovery that the printer is defective according to the manufacturer.
I have filed a complaint with Ebay and PayPal and am awaiting resolution. Regardless of their decisions, however, I would avoid doing business with Mr Kerans and Wholesale Server Components or any other entity with which he is affiliated.
Mr Kerans has offered to accept the return of the printer, but refuses to reimburse me for shipping ($70) despite his fraudulent advertising and attempted deception.
